Jumps Workshop
The workshop is aimed at Coaching Assistant and Athletics Coach level. The format will be a 1.5 hour theory based session on physical preparation and planning and a 1.5 hour practical session, the practical session will have an event specialist (triple / long / high) to help solve common faults faced when coaching your athletes and give you tools to solve them. Coach Development – Physical Prep
Focussing on how athletes can improve mobility, movement and therefore athletic performance, this workshop builds on the content in the England Athletics Movement Skills workshop. This workshop looks at movement assessment and interventions including use of foam rollers, hurdle mobility and coordination drills and strength training progressions.
